What is the significance of the Three Sisters quote?
The Three Sisters quote comes from a play of the same name by Anton Chekhov. The play tells the story of three sisters who long to return to their home in Moscow after living in the provinces for many years. The quote itself refers to the sisters' desire to escape their mundane lives and find happiness:
